The united nations of London: Map reveals the areas where 50% of residents are born abroad as capital's population hits record 8.6million

London map reveals the areas where 50% of residents are born abroad
Analysis of official data released by the Mayor of London Boris Johnson reveals that in several areas more than half the population was born outside the UK, with India being the main place of origin in eight of the capital's 32 boroughs. Residents originally from Nigeria, Poland, Turkey and Bangladesh are the other main foreign-born populations, dominating in at least three boroughs each. London's inner boroughs have a far higher immigrant population than its outer boroughs, with the higher concentrations marked in darker colours on the map.
